Hes the perfect example of what happens to these 250 class guys. You make it to being a pro, but unless you reallllly do something and stand out your gonna be stuck there for a while then just have to move on to other things in life. There needs to be more contracts in the 450s. Martin with 2 titles shouldnt still be on 250's, same with Osbourne at 30 years old, or Alex Martin. It should be the young guns in the 250s like Fornker, Cooper, Hampshire, Marchbanks...etc. All these other dudes should be making the 450 class the true premier class where its stacked with talent. As it is now the 250 class has the most talent.
